Abstract

The utility model discloses a power supply system of an integrated audio frequency amplification circuit. The power supply system comprises a power supply module and an audio frequency amplification module in connection with a mainboard. One output end of the power supply module is connected with the power input end of the audio frequency amplification module, and the power supply module and the audio frequency amplification module are integrated on a same circuit board. By adopting the power supply system provided by the utility model, the connecting wires between the power supply module and the audio frequency module is reduced, the occupied space of the circuit board is reduced, and the electrical performance is improved; moreover, the power supply system has short signal path and high anti-electromagnetic interference capacity.

Technical field
The utility model relates to electric supply system, especially relates to the electric supply system of integrated audio amplifying return circuit.
Background technology
At present the audio frequency amplification module of the power supply module of electric supply system and audio amplifier system is two modules independently, be located at respectively on the different circuit boards, the output of power supply module is connected by the power input of connecting line with the audio frequency amplification module, for this audio amplifier system provides power supply.Because the connecting line of two modules comes off easily, causes between two systems and exists potential safety hazard.
The utility model content
In order to overcome above-mentioned shortcoming, main purpose of the present utility model is to provide the electric supply system that need not the integrated audio amplifying return circuit that connecting line is connected between a kind of power supply module and audio frequency amplification module.
The utility model comprises power supply module and the audio frequency amplification module that links to each other with mainboard, one output of described power supply module links to each other with the power input of described audio frequency amplification module, and described power supply module and described audio frequency amplification module are integrated on the same circuit board.Therefore, need not connecting line between the utility model power supply module and audio frequency amplification module and be connected, can prevent the problem that connecting line comes off.
The utility model compared with prior art has following advantage: 1, reduced the be connected wire rod of power supply module with audio-frequency module, can prevent problem that connecting line comes off and safer; 2, reduce the volume that circuit board takies, improved electric property; 3, signal path is shorter, and anti-electromagnetic interference capability is strong.
